See the IRS Farmers Tax Guide for details. When managing for native wildlife and insect species, a landowner is not exempt from paying taxes, rather they are taxed at a low ag tax rate. As a landowner, you will only qualify for wildlife sanctuary tax benefits if you have used the particular land, within a specific period, for at least three of the following functions: providing supplemental water, habitat control, predator control, providing shelter, making census counts to determine population and providing supplemental food. These include habitat control, erosion control, predator control, supplemental water, supplemental food, providing shelter, and census counts. From 2006 to 2014, a tax incentive temporarily boosted the allowable deduction for conservation easements to 50% of AGI, or 100% for certain ranchers and farmers.
